From: Dimitry Andric Date: Sat, 17 Feb 2018 21:04:35 +0000 (+0000) Subject: [X86] Add 'sahf' CPU feature to frontend X-Git-Url: https://granicus.if.org/sourcecode?a=commitdiff_plain;h=4bc099ffd7c59c0a4a65b36d2426b8790c1df3c9;p=clang [X86] Add 'sahf' CPU feature to frontend Summary: Make clang accept `-msahf` (and `-mno-sahf`) flags to activate the `+sahf` feature for the backend, for bug 36028 (Incorrect use of pushf/popf enables/disables interrupts on amd64 kernels). This was originally submitted in bug 36037 by Jonathan Looney . As described there, GCC also uses `-msahf` for this feature, and the backend already recognizes the `+sahf` feature. All that is needed is to teach clang to pass this on to the backend. The mapping of feature support onto CPUs may not be complete; rather, it was chosen to match LLVM's idea of which CPUs support this feature (see lib/Target/X86/X86.td). I also updated the affected test case (CodeGen/attr-target-x86.c) to match the emitted output.
